Romantic Blogginess

I am new to this whole blog thing, and I think I am addicted. It is funny though because I feel like I keep looking and looking, and my intensely selective brain starts to alter itself into a less intensely selective state. The whole presentation is very romantic, and bloggers keep talking about this image or that image getting stuck in their mind. I can sympathize with that feeling, but it seems easy to get wrapped up in the presentation of an image as good instead of the image actually being good. It is kind of nice though, this romantic notion of any photo being declared amazing by simply existing on the web and being seen by another blogger.
